Why Tire Diameter Matters on a Tractor

Tractor tires come in many shapes and sizes, and each one affects how the tractor behaves. Accurate diameter measurements help you:

  • Ensure proper gear ratios and speed calculations
  • Match tire sizes in 4WD systems
  • Improve traction and balance
  • Optimize field coverage and fuel use

Calculate Tire Diameter from Size Instantly

If you’re wondering how to calculate tire diameter from size, here’s the basic formula used in our calculator:

Diameter = (Section Width × Aspect Ratio × 2) ÷ 25.4 + Rim Diameter

This gives you the full outer diameter of the tire in inches. You can also compare results with our tool for added accuracy.

How Do Tractor Tire Sizes Work?

Tractor tires use different formats depending on the model and country. Some use standard imperial units like 18.4-38, while others use metric formats like 420/85R34.
